How are you compensated?
In many tenant representation engagements, compensation is paid through a brokerage fee that is negotiated as part of the transaction and shared between the listing broker and tenant’s broker. In those cases, tenants are able to receive professional representation without paying a separate out-of-pocket fee. For advisory-only or non-traditional engagements, compensation is discussed upfront based on scope.
